What does resource industries — goodwill mean?
Represents the excess of the purchase price over the fair value of identifiable net assets acquired in business combinations specifically allocated to the Resource Industries segment. This asset reflects the premium paid for intangible synergies, brand reputation, and market position within the mining and heavy equipment sector. It is subject to periodic impairment testing to ensure the carrying value remains supported by future cash flows.
